St. Joseph Hill Academy High School established the Career Conversations: Alumnae Panel Series in 2021 and 2024 marks our fourth consecutive year. 
 
The Alumnae Panel Series is fully virtual, tapping Hill Alumnae from across the country and those who work internationally as well (we have even had some alumnae logging in at 1:00 am local time to participate!). They join current students for an evening of stimulating conversation on their career paths. The series is jointly organized by the College Counseling and Alumni Relations Offices and invites a small group of alumnae speakers for each event focused on a particular professional field. 
 
Students gain valuable insight and make lasting connections to our generous alumnae. The Alumnae Panel Series inspires students' curiosities as they consider their future college plans and career aspirations of their own.
